Keywords Autosuggests
Keywords Autosuggest tool offers autocomplete options for the words typed in the app stores’ search bars by users.
Use this tool to find all the possible variations of the keywords your app may be found by and add them to your app's semantic core. Using suggested keywords will likely increase your app’s visibility in app stores.
Application: Get all the suggestions for the keywords your app is searched with.
Goal: Improve app visibility in the app store by using keywords your app may be found with.
Time: Up to 5 minutes.
Add a Keyword
In the search bar, type the keyword to find its autosuggestions.
Adjust Display Settings
Select the language you need according to your app localization from the dropdown list. The countries where the keyword is most popular are listed first. Also, you can choose a popularity range. Set the parameters manually or pick one of the three preset options.
You can also expand blocks for each letter by selecting “Expand All.”
Choose Keyword Autosuggestions
1. Popular keyword autosuggestions
The first block contains the most popular autosuggestions for the chosen keyword. Sort them alphabetically or in ascending/descending order of popularity. You can add all keywords from this section to Tracking or select particular ones. If you check the box “Show added,” the keywords added to Tracking will be shown with a green checkmark.
2. Autosuggestions in alphabetical order
Next, examine the autosuggest for each letter of the alphabet. Expand blocks to see all available options and the popularity of each keyword. Add keywords effective for your app search intent to the Tracking, your semantic core.
This way, you can study all the keyword autosuggestions and add them to Tracking one by one, by block, or use the bulk adding option and add all keyword autosuggestions by clicking the “Add All Keywords” button. Also, all these keywords can be exported to a .csv file.
